
Blue Crabs Avoid Sweep with 3-2 Extra Inning Win

Bridgewater, NJ- The Southern Maryland Blue Crabs defeated the Somerset Patriots 3-2 in ten innings before 5,638 fans at TD Bank Ballpark on Sunday afternoon.
Southern Maryland broke the 2-2 tie in the tenth on a sacrifice fly by Casey Benjamin for the 3-2 final.
The Patriots took a 1-0 lead in the sixth on back-to-back doubles by Jonny Tucker and Freddie Bynum.
The Blue Crabs evened up the game in the seventh on an RBI single by Christian Lopez.
Southern Maryland took the lead in the ninth after Benjamin singled and later scored on an error that allowed Mike Daniel to score for a 2-1 advantage.
The Patriots answered right back, tying up the game in the bottom of the ninth on a bases loaded walk to Tucker that made the score 2-2.
Jim Ed Warden (1-2) picked up the win, allowing a run in an inning pitched. Travis Bowyer (0-1) suffered the loss, allowing a run in an inning of work. Bryan Dumesnil earned his first save of the season.
Patriots starter Doug Arguello pitched five no hit innings and struck out eight in a row before the bullpen took over.
